Item Real-time Rendering of Deformable Translucent Objects(The Eurographics Association, 2009) Benmounah, Nadir; Jolivet, Vincent; Ghazanfarpour, Djamchid; Wen Tang and John CollomosseThis paper introduces an efficient real-time shading model to simulate light transport in translucent materials. In this work no pre-processing step is needed, allowing us to deform translucent objects at interactive rates. The proposed technique avoids the pre-processing of texture atlas and texture coordinates that may entail distortions and self-occlusion errors. We create a cube map texture atlas on the GPU by a specific projection providing accurate access to neighborhood information is accurate. The texture atlas is generated on-the-fly each time the mesh geometry is modified, allowing us to deform the object geometry in real time keeping valid the subsurface light transport computation.
